You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Southern Illinois University Carbondale.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Electrical Technology Schools in Illinois For Those Making $48-$75k. Southern Illinois University Carbondale is a fairly large public school situated in Carbondale, Illinois. It awarded 10 ’s electrical technology degrees in 2019-2020.
SIUC did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best Electrical, Electronic & Communications Engineering Technology Schools in Illinois” list. The estimated yearly cost for SIUC is $14,985 for Illinois Electrical Technology students whose families make $48-$75k.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Lake Land College.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value Electrical Technology Schools in Illinois For Those Making $48-$75k list. Lake Land College is located in Mattoon, Illinois and, has a small student population. In 2019-2020, this school awarded 5 ’s electrical technology degrees to qualified students.
In addition to being on our illinois electrical technology students whose families make $48-$75k list, Lake Land College has also earned the #3 rank in our “Best Electrical, Electronic & Communications Engineering Technology Schools in Illinois” ranking. The yearly cost to attend Lake Land College is $6,770 for Illinois Electrical Technology students whose families make $48-$75k.
You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end DeVry University - Illinois. It ranked #3 on our 2022 Best Value Electrical Technology Schools in Illinois For Those Making $48-$75k list. DeVry University - Illinois is a private for-profit institution located in Chicago, Illinois. The school has a large population, and it awarded 132 ’s degrees in 2019-2020.
DeVry University - Illinois also made our “Best Electrical, Electronic & Communications Engineering Technology Schools in Illinois” list, coming in at #2. The yearly cost to attend DeVry University - Illinois is $29,583 for Illinois Electrical Technology students whose families make $48-$75k.
